- [ ] Step 7: Archive cold storage buckets (Glacierline tier). Confirm both ceremony witnesses are present, verify bucket manifests match the Oxbow ledger, then seal the archive key shares. Plugin authors may observe but not handle shares. Once sealed, the archive index itself is encrypted and can only be reopened with the passphrase below.

vault phrase of badup-hahig = tamael-aldael-kelmir-istael-fenok-istwyn-tamius-jorath-oliion

**Handover: SnapCheck suite**

Hey future maintainers — SnapCheck runs snapshot tests on our Glimmer UI components every merge. Baselines live in the Torvell bucket; regenerate them only after a deliberate design change, not to silence diffs (looking at you, past me). Flaky date-based components are masked in the harness. The runner reads the following config at startup.

service settings:
[casax]
port = 6379
team = rusir
host = casax.zemvarhq.corp
region = outer-4
access_code = ac_9808ce
timeout_ms = 1500

# Vantmark Environments

Welcome! Vantmark is our GPU memory profiling tool, and it runs in three environments: dev, shadow, and prod. Dev is a free-for-all, shadow mirrors real workloads from the Ketterly render farm, and prod is where the actual allocation traces get captured. Don't profile against prod unless you've cleared it with the team. Each environment pulls its settings from the same template, and prod currently uses these values.

deployment values, bagag-bawig:
DRUVAN_PIN=0740
DRUVAN_TENANT=wendor
DRUVAN_METRICS_HOST=metrics.druvan.tolvaqnet.example
DRUVAN_SEAL=seal_75cd0b2d
DRUVAN_STANDBY_TEAM=tamael

## Deployment

Muffleron deploys as a single stateless container behind the Torwick gateway. Deduplication state lives entirely in the shared cache, so replicas can scale horizontally without coordination. Reviewers should verify the rollout manifest matches staging before approving. The configuration the service boots with in production is shown below.

deployment values, bagaf-kagag:
istael:
  pin: 2777
  tenant: tamvan
  seal: seal_75cefd5e
  metrics_host: metrics.istael.qirvanio.example
  standby_team: holion
  escalation: kelmir-drudor
  nonce: d13cd7